We would like to introduce a case study of the inventory management service "KG ZAICO" implemented at Sumitomo Metal Mining Co., Ltd. aimed at preventing excess inventory and reducing costs. Previously, inventory management for heavy machinery parts was conducted using Excel, and the number of part types had increased by about 20% compared to five years ago, with the inventory value rising by approximately 50%. After implementation, inventory processing is conducted upon delivery of ordered parts, and inventory is processed when parts are used for maintenance, allowing for real-time confirmation of current inventory levels.
